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Проблемы с распределенными транзакциями (MSDTC)  [new]
DKrosh
Guest
Вопрос может быть из разряда покажи то, не знаю что, пойди туда - не знаю куда. Вообщем общий вопрос.

Коллеги подскажите плиз, из-за чего могут не проходить распределенные транзакции. (в одной базе используются линки на внешнюю базу)
SQLServer 2000 со всеми SP.

Спасибо.
6 окт 05, 12:03    [1943774]     Ответить | Цитировать Сообщить модератору
 Re: Проблемы с распределенными транзакциями (MSDTC)  [new]
GreenSunrise
Member

Откуда:
Сообщений: 12310
В чем выражается "непроходимость"?
6 окт 05, 14:01    [1944547]     Ответить | Цитировать Сообщить модератору
 Re: Проблемы с распределенными транзакциями (MSDTC)  [new]
GMSUka
Member

Откуда: Ukraine
Сообщений: 113
Операционка на обеих серверах?
6 окт 05, 14:35    [1944764]     Ответить | Цитировать Сообщить модератору
 Re: Проблемы с распределенными транзакциями (MSDTC)  [new]
DKrosh
Guest
Операционки 2003 SP1.

Java приложение не может выполнить распределенную транзакцию.

The operation could not be performed because the OLE DB provider 'MSDAORA' was unable to begin a distributed transaction

Вот кусок стек трейса
Caused by: java.sql.SQLException: [Microsoft][SQLServer JDBC Driver][SQLServer]The operation could not be performed because the OLE DB provider 'MSDASQL' was unable to begin a distributed transaction.
at com.microsoft.jdbc.base.BaseExceptions.createException(Unknown Source)
at com.microsoft.jdbc.base.BaseExceptions.getException(Unknown Source)
at com.microsoft.jdbc.sqlserver.tds.TDSRequest.processErrorToken(Unknown Source)
at com.microsoft.jdbc.sqlserver.tds.TDSRequest.processReplyToken(Unknown Source)
at com.microsoft.jdbc.sqlserver.tds.TDSRPCRequest.processReplyToken(Unknown Source)
at com.microsoft.jdbc.sqlserver.tds.TDSRequest.processReply(Unknown Source)
at com.microsoft.jdbc.sqlserver.tds.TDSCursorRequest.openCursor(Unknown Source)
at com.microsoft.jdbc.sqlserver.SQLServerImplStatement.execute(Unknown Source)
at com.microsoft.jdbc.base.BaseStatement.commonExecute(Unknown Source)
at com.microsoft.jdbc.base.BaseStatement.executeQueryInternal(Unknown Source)
at com.microsoft.jdbc.base.BasePreparedStatement.executeQuery(Unknown Source)
6 окт 05, 16:09    [1945359]     Ответить | Цитировать Сообщить модератору
 Re: Проблемы с распределенными транзакциями (MSDTC)  [new]
SQLasik
Guest
Попробуй тут: http://www.support.microsoft.com/?kbid=555017
6 окт 05, 16:24    [1945483]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ить